Buffalo's Wood Fence Lifespan: Factors Affecting Durability In Harsh Winters

how long do wood fences last in buffalo new york

Wood fences in Buffalo, New York, face unique challenges due to the region's harsh climate, characterized by heavy snowfall, freezing temperatures, and humid summers. These conditions can significantly impact the lifespan of wood fences, typically ranging from 10 to 20 years, depending on factors such as the type of wood, maintenance practices, and exposure to moisture and pests. Proper installation, regular staining or sealing, and prompt repairs can help extend their durability, while untreated or poorly maintained fences may deteriorate more quickly under Buffalo's demanding weather conditions.

Climate impact on wood fences

Buffalo, New York, experiences a humid continental climate characterized by cold, snowy winters and warm, humid summers. These extremes play a significant role in the lifespan of wood fences. Winter’s freezing temperatures and heavy snowfall can cause wood to contract, crack, and warp, while summer’s high humidity and moisture accelerate rot and fungal growth. Understanding these climate-specific challenges is crucial for homeowners aiming to maximize their fence’s durability.

To combat Buffalo’s harsh winters, consider using pressure-treated wood, which is infused with preservatives to resist decay and insect damage. Applying a waterproof sealant annually can further protect against moisture penetration from snow and ice. Additionally, installing the fence with proper drainage in mind—such as ensuring the ground slopes away from the fence—prevents water pooling at the base, a common cause of rot. These proactive measures can extend a wood fence’s lifespan by 5–10 years in this climate.

Summer’s humidity poses a different threat: mold, mildew, and warping. To mitigate this, choose wood species naturally resistant to moisture, like cedar or redwood, which contain natural oils that deter fungal growth. Regularly inspect the fence for signs of mold or warping, and clean it with a mild bleach solution (1 cup bleach per gallon of water) to inhibit fungal development. Trimming vegetation around the fence also improves airflow, reducing moisture buildup.

A comparative analysis of maintenance strategies reveals that combining material selection with seasonal care yields the best results. For instance, while pressure-treated pine is cost-effective, it requires more frequent sealing compared to cedar, which is pricier but more resilient. Homeowners should weigh these factors based on their budget and willingness to perform upkeep. In Buffalo’s climate, investing in higher-quality materials and maintenance can double a fence’s lifespan from 10–15 years to 20–25 years.

Finally, consider the long-term impact of climate change, which may bring wetter winters and hotter summers to Buffalo. Future-proofing your fence involves not only choosing durable materials but also adopting adaptive practices, such as installing fence posts deeper than the frost line to prevent heaving during freeze-thaw cycles. By anticipating these shifts, homeowners can ensure their wood fences remain functional and aesthetically pleasing for decades.

Best wood types for durability

In Buffalo, New York, where harsh winters and humid summers test the limits of outdoor structures, choosing the right wood for your fence is critical to its longevity. Among the top contenders for durability, cedar stands out due to its natural resistance to rot, decay, and insect damage. Its tight grain and high oil content make it less susceptible to moisture absorption, a key factor in preventing warping and splitting. While cedar fences can last 15–30 years with proper maintenance, their initial cost is higher than treated pine, making them a long-term investment rather than a budget option.

For those seeking a more economical choice without sacrificing durability, pressure-treated pine is a practical alternative. Treated with chemicals to resist rot and pests, this wood can withstand Buffalo’s wet springs and snowy winters for 12–20 years. However, its lifespan depends heavily on maintenance—regular staining or sealing every 2–3 years is essential to protect against moisture penetration. Unlike cedar, treated pine lacks natural oils, so neglecting maintenance will accelerate deterioration, particularly in areas prone to ground contact or constant moisture exposure.

If you’re willing to venture beyond traditional options, redwood offers exceptional durability, though its availability and cost in Buffalo may be limiting factors. Native to the West Coast, redwood contains tannins and oils that deter insects and resist decay, similar to cedar. Fences made from redwood can last 20–30 years with minimal upkeep, but transportation costs often make it pricier than local options. For Buffalo homeowners, redwood is best suited for smaller projects or decorative elements rather than entire fences.

Lastly, cypress is an underutilized yet highly durable wood that thrives in wet conditions, making it ideal for Buffalo’s climate. Its natural resistance to decay and ability to retain shape under moisture stress rival that of cedar. Cypress fences typically last 20–25 years, and their stability reduces the need for frequent repairs. However, sourcing cypress in the Northeast can be challenging, and its cost often falls between cedar and redwood. For those prioritizing longevity and willing to invest in material quality, cypress is a strong contender.

In summary, the best wood for durability in Buffalo’s climate depends on your budget, maintenance commitment, and aesthetic preferences. Cedar and cypress offer natural resilience with longer lifespans, while treated pine provides a cost-effective solution requiring diligent upkeep. Redwood, though durable, may be impractical for large-scale projects due to cost and availability. Regardless of choice, regular staining, sealing, and inspections are non-negotiable to maximize any fence’s lifespan in Buffalo’s demanding weather.

Maintenance tips to extend lifespan

Wood fences in Buffalo, New York, face a unique set of challenges due to the region’s harsh winters, heavy snowfall, and humid summers. Without proper care, these elements can accelerate decay, warping, and rot, significantly shortening a fence’s lifespan. However, with strategic maintenance, a wood fence can endure 15–20 years or more, even in Buffalo’s demanding climate.

Inspect and Repair Annually

Begin by inspecting your fence each spring, after winter’s toll. Look for loose boards, splintered posts, or signs of rot, particularly at ground level where moisture accumulates. Replace damaged sections promptly to prevent further deterioration. Tighten or reinforce hardware like hinges and latches, which can loosen under the weight of snow or frost heave. For fences older than 5 years, consider hiring a professional to assess structural integrity, as issues like leaning posts may require specialized tools to correct.

Seal and Stain Every 2–3 Years

Buffalo’s humidity and temperature fluctuations cause wood to expand and contract, leading to cracks and splits. Apply a high-quality, semi-transparent stain with a water-repellent sealant to protect against moisture and UV damage. Choose a product rated for extreme climates, and ensure it penetrates the wood rather than merely coating the surface. For best results, clean the fence with a mild detergent and pressure washer (on low setting) before application, removing mildew and debris. Reapply stain every 2–3 years, or when water no longer beads on the surface.

Manage Snow and Vegetation

Snow piled against a fence can trap moisture and increase pressure, causing posts to lean or boards to warp. After heavy snowfall, use a shovel or snowblower to create a 6–12 inch gap between the fence and snowdrifts. Avoid leaning heavy objects like ladders or trash cans against the fence year-round, as this can weaken supports. Additionally, trim vegetation within 12 inches of the fence to reduce moisture retention and discourage pests like termites, which thrive in damp, shaded areas.

Elevate and Ventilate

To combat ground moisture, ensure fence posts are set in concrete with proper drainage. For existing fences, install gravel or crushed stone around the base to improve water runoff. If your fence borders a lawn, adjust sprinklers to avoid direct overspray, as constant wetting accelerates rot. For added protection, attach a kickboard—a horizontal board along the bottom—to shield the fence from snow, rain, and lawn equipment. This simple addition can extend the fence’s life by 3–5 years.

By combining proactive inspections, protective treatments, and environmental management, homeowners in Buffalo can maximize their wood fence’s durability. While the climate poses challenges, consistent maintenance transforms these obstacles into manageable tasks, ensuring the fence remains functional and attractive for decades.

Common fence deterioration factors

Wood fences in Buffalo, New York, face a unique set of challenges due to the region's harsh climate and environmental conditions. Understanding the common factors that contribute to fence deterioration is crucial for homeowners looking to maximize the lifespan of their wooden fences. Here, we delve into these factors, offering insights and practical advice.

The Impact of Moisture and Humidity: Buffalo's climate is characterized by cold, snowy winters and humid summers, creating a perfect storm for wood fence deterioration. Prolonged exposure to moisture is a primary culprit. When wood absorbs water, it expands, and as it dries, it contracts. This constant cycle leads to warping, cracking, and splitting. In areas with high humidity, such as near Lake Erie, the moisture content in the air can accelerate this process. To mitigate this, consider applying a waterproof sealant annually, especially after the wet spring season. This simple maintenance task can significantly extend the fence's life by creating a barrier against moisture penetration.

Battling the Elements: Wind and Sun: The region's windy conditions and intense sunlight further contribute to fence degradation. Strong winds can cause physical damage, loosening posts and boards over time. This is particularly noticeable in open areas where the fence acts as a windbreak. Regular inspections after storms are essential to identify and repair any structural weaknesses. Additionally, the sun's UV rays break down wood fibers, leading to fading, brittleness, and surface degradation. A protective stain or paint with UV inhibitors can counteract this, preserving the wood's integrity and appearance. Opt for products specifically designed for exterior wood, ensuring they are reapplied every 2-3 years for optimal protection.

Soil and Ground Conditions: The type of soil and ground conditions in Buffalo can also affect fence longevity. Clay-rich soils, common in the area, tend to expand when wet and contract when dry, putting pressure on fence posts. This movement can cause posts to shift, lean, or even crack. Ensuring proper drainage around the fence line is vital. Consider installing gravel backfill around posts to facilitate water runoff and reduce soil-related stress. For new installations, treating the bottom of wooden posts with a wood preservative can provide an extra layer of protection against ground moisture and insects.

Biological Threats: Insects and Fungi: Buffalo's environment also poses biological threats to wood fences. Termites and carpenter ants are common pests that can infest and damage wood, especially if it's already weakened by moisture. Regular inspections for insect activity are crucial, and prompt treatment with appropriate insecticides is necessary to prevent infestations. Fungi, such as mold and mildew, thrive in damp conditions, causing wood rot and discoloration. To discourage fungal growth, ensure the fence is well-ventilated and promptly remove any debris or vegetation in contact with the wood. Pressure-treated wood, which has been infused with preservatives, offers enhanced resistance to both insects and fungi, making it a wise choice for fence construction in this region.

By addressing these common deterioration factors, homeowners in Buffalo can significantly enhance the durability of their wood fences. Regular maintenance, strategic material choices, and proactive measures against environmental elements are key to preserving the fence's structural integrity and aesthetic appeal over the long term. This tailored approach ensures that wood fences not only withstand the unique challenges of the Buffalo climate but also provide a long-lasting and attractive boundary solution.

Average lifespan in Buffalo weather

Buffalo's harsh winters and humid summers create a unique challenge for wood fences. The average lifespan of a wood fence in this climate is significantly shorter than in milder regions, typically ranging from 10 to 15 years. This is due to the relentless cycle of freezing temperatures, snow, and ice, followed by hot, humid conditions that promote moisture retention and wood rot.
